Gravel pad installation services involve preparing a stable and level foundation by laying down gravel in designated areas. This process typically includes site assessment, grading, and the placement of gravel layers to ensure proper drainage and support. The goal is to create a durable surface that can withstand various loads and environmental conditions, making it suitable for a range of applications such as driveways, equipment pads, or walkways. Professional installers ensure that the gravel is evenly distributed and compacted to provide a solid base that minimizes shifting and settling over time.
One of the primary issues gravel pad installation helps address is drainage problems. Without a proper foundation, water can pool or seep into underlying soil, leading to erosion, mud accumulation, and instability. A well-installed gravel pad facilitates effective water runoff, reducing the risk of flooding and damage to structures or vehicles. Additionally, it helps prevent uneven surfaces and sinking that can occur with poorly supported ground, ensuring a safer and more functional area for various outdoor activities or equipment placement.

Material Costs - The cost of gravel material for a pad typically ranges from $1 to $3 per square foot, depending on the type and quality of gravel selected. For example, a 10x10-foot pad may cost between $100 and $300 for mater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total costs varying based on project size and site conditions. A standard gravel pad installation might require 4 to 8 hours of work, totaling $200 to $800.
Site Preparation - Preparing the site for gravel pad installation can add $200 to $500 to the overall cost, covering excavation, leveling, and base material. Larger or more complex sites may incur higher preparation expenses.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include delivery charges for gravel, which typically range from $50 to $150, and potential permits or inspection fees. These additional expenses can influence the final project budget.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a gravel pad? A gravel pad is a prepared layer of compacted gravel used as a stable foundation for structures such as sheds, decks, or driveways.
